Subject: Re: [PATCH rdma-rc] RDMA/cma: Limit join multicast to UD QP type only

On Tue, Apr 12, 2022 at 05:01:36PM +0200, Christoph Lameter wrote:
> On Tue, 12 Apr 2022, Jason Gunthorpe wrote:
> 
> > The only places setting non-default qkeys are SIDR, maybe nobody uses
> > SIDR with multicast.
> 
> 
> IP port numbers provided are ignored by the RDMA subsytem when doing
> multicast joins. Thus no need to do SIDRs with RDMA multicast.
> 
> Some middleware solutions (like LLM by IBM and Confinity) are creating
> their own custom MGID because of this problem. The custom MGID will then
> contain the port number.
> 
> On the subject of this patch: There is a usecase for Multicast with
> IBV_QPT_RAW_PACKET too. A multicast join is required to redirect traffic
> for a multicast group to the raw socket.

The qp_type in rdma-cm is a little bit misleading and represents
communication QP. It can be or RC or UD, which is hard coded in
almost all rdma-cm code.

The one of the places that receive it from the user space is ucma_get_qp_type()
for RDMA_PS_IB flow,  but librdmacm set it to RC too.

   790
   791 int rdma_create_id(struct rdma_event_channel *channel,
   792                    struct rdma_cm_id **id, void *context,
   793                    enum rdma_port_space ps)
   794 {
   795         enum ibv_qp_type qp_type;
   796
   797         qp_type = (ps == RDMA_PS_IPOIB || ps == RDMA_PS_UDP) ?
   798                   IBV_QPT_UD : IBV_QPT_RC;
   799         return rdma_create_id2(channel, id, context, ps, qp_type);
   800 }
   801
